#78c045 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#78c045 is composed of 47.1% red, 75.3% green and 27.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 37.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 64.1% yellow and 24.7% black. It has a hue angle of 95.1 degrees, a saturation of 49.4% and a lightness of 51.2%. #78c045 color hex could be obtained by blending #f0ff8a with #008100.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

#78c045 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#78c045 has RGB values of R:120, G:192, B:69 and CMYK values of C:0.38, M:0, Y:0.64,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 7913541.
